How Reliable is the Toyota RAV4?

Based on 1,827,031 MOT tests across 166,014 vehicles.

79.8%
Pass Rate
6,112
Miles/Year
32
Year Lifespan
166,014
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 26,391
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 22,816
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 20,079
Brake pipe excessively corroded 17,023
position lamp(s) not working 15,294

PK52 ENP is a 2002 Toyota RAV4 in Silver with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 27 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 2002 Toyota RAV4 models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.7% with a typical mileage of 81,819 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Toyota RAV4 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 26,391 recorded failures. If you're considering buying PK52 ENP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Toyota RAV4 typically stays on UK roads for around 32 years. At 24 years old, this Toyota RAV4 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
